Home
last modified time | relevance | path

Searched refs:base_mem_alloc_flags (Results 1 – 9 of 9) sorted by relevance

/device/soc/rockchip/common/vendor/drivers/gpu/arm/bifrost/csf/
Dmali_base_csf_kernel.h34 #define BASE_MEM_PROT_CPU_RD ((base_mem_alloc_flags)1 << 0)
38 #define BASE_MEM_PROT_CPU_WR ((base_mem_alloc_flags)1 << 1)
42 #define BASE_MEM_PROT_GPU_RD ((base_mem_alloc_flags)1 << 2)
46 #define BASE_MEM_PROT_GPU_WR ((base_mem_alloc_flags)1 << 3)
50 #define BASE_MEM_PROT_GPU_EX ((base_mem_alloc_flags)1 << 4)
55 #define BASEP_MEM_PERMANENT_KERNEL_MAPPING ((base_mem_alloc_flags)1 << 5)
63 #define BASE_MEM_GPU_VA_SAME_4GB_PAGE ((base_mem_alloc_flags)1 << 6)
68 #define BASEP_MEM_NO_USER_FREE ((base_mem_alloc_flags)1 << 7)
70 #define BASE_MEM_RESERVED_BIT_8 ((base_mem_alloc_flags)1 << 8)
74 #define BASE_MEM_GROW_ON_GPF ((base_mem_alloc_flags)1 << 9)
[all …]
/device/soc/rockchip/rk3588/kernel/include/uapi/gpu/arm/bifrost/csf/
Dmali_base_csf_kernel.h35 #define BASE_MEM_PROT_CPU_RD ((base_mem_alloc_flags)1 << 0)
39 #define BASE_MEM_PROT_CPU_WR ((base_mem_alloc_flags)1 << 1)
43 #define BASE_MEM_PROT_GPU_RD ((base_mem_alloc_flags)1 << 2)
47 #define BASE_MEM_PROT_GPU_WR ((base_mem_alloc_flags)1 << 3)
51 #define BASE_MEM_PROT_GPU_EX ((base_mem_alloc_flags)1 << 4)
56 #define BASEP_MEM_PERMANENT_KERNEL_MAPPING ((base_mem_alloc_flags)1 << 5)
64 #define BASE_MEM_GPU_VA_SAME_4GB_PAGE ((base_mem_alloc_flags)1 << 6)
69 #define BASEP_MEM_NO_USER_FREE ((base_mem_alloc_flags)1 << 7)
71 #define BASE_MEM_RESERVED_BIT_8 ((base_mem_alloc_flags)1 << 8)
75 #define BASE_MEM_GROW_ON_GPF ((base_mem_alloc_flags)1 << 9)
[all …]
/device/soc/rockchip/common/vendor/drivers/gpu/arm/bifrost/jm/
Dmali_base_jm_kernel.h38 #define BASE_MEM_PROT_CPU_RD ((base_mem_alloc_flags)1 << 0)
42 #define BASE_MEM_PROT_CPU_WR ((base_mem_alloc_flags)1 << 1)
46 #define BASE_MEM_PROT_GPU_RD ((base_mem_alloc_flags)1 << 2)
50 #define BASE_MEM_PROT_GPU_WR ((base_mem_alloc_flags)1 << 3)
54 #define BASE_MEM_PROT_GPU_EX ((base_mem_alloc_flags)1 << 4)
59 #define BASEP_MEM_PERMANENT_KERNEL_MAPPING ((base_mem_alloc_flags)1 << 5)
67 #define BASE_MEM_GPU_VA_SAME_4GB_PAGE ((base_mem_alloc_flags)1 << 6)
72 #define BASEP_MEM_NO_USER_FREE ((base_mem_alloc_flags)1 << 7)
74 #define BASE_MEM_RESERVED_BIT_8 ((base_mem_alloc_flags)1 << 8)
78 #define BASE_MEM_GROW_ON_GPF ((base_mem_alloc_flags)1 << 9)
[all …]
/device/soc/rockchip/rk3588/kernel/include/uapi/gpu/arm/bifrost/jm/
Dmali_base_jm_kernel.h35 #define BASE_MEM_PROT_CPU_RD ((base_mem_alloc_flags)1 << 0)
39 #define BASE_MEM_PROT_CPU_WR ((base_mem_alloc_flags)1 << 1)
43 #define BASE_MEM_PROT_GPU_RD ((base_mem_alloc_flags)1 << 2)
47 #define BASE_MEM_PROT_GPU_WR ((base_mem_alloc_flags)1 << 3)
51 #define BASE_MEM_PROT_GPU_EX ((base_mem_alloc_flags)1 << 4)
56 #define BASEP_MEM_PERMANENT_KERNEL_MAPPING ((base_mem_alloc_flags)1 << 5)
64 #define BASE_MEM_GPU_VA_SAME_4GB_PAGE ((base_mem_alloc_flags)1 << 6)
69 #define BASEP_MEM_NO_USER_FREE ((base_mem_alloc_flags)1 << 7)
71 #define BASE_MEM_RESERVED_BIT_8 ((base_mem_alloc_flags)1 << 8)
75 #define BASE_MEM_GROW_ON_GPF ((base_mem_alloc_flags)1 << 9)
[all …]
/device/soc/rockchip/common/kernel/drivers/gpu/arm/midgard/
Dmali_base_kernel.h132 typedef u32 base_mem_alloc_flags; typedef
142 #define BASE_MEM_PROT_CPU_RD ((base_mem_alloc_flags)1 << 0)
146 #define BASE_MEM_PROT_CPU_WR ((base_mem_alloc_flags)1 << 1)
150 #define BASE_MEM_PROT_GPU_RD ((base_mem_alloc_flags)1 << 2)
154 #define BASE_MEM_PROT_GPU_WR ((base_mem_alloc_flags)1 << 3)
158 #define BASE_MEM_PROT_GPU_EX ((base_mem_alloc_flags)1 << 4)
173 #define BASE_MEM_GROW_ON_GPF ((base_mem_alloc_flags)1 << 9)
177 #define BASE_MEM_COHERENT_SYSTEM ((base_mem_alloc_flags)1 << 10)
181 #define BASE_MEM_COHERENT_LOCAL ((base_mem_alloc_flags)1 << 11)
185 #define BASE_MEM_CACHED_CPU ((base_mem_alloc_flags)1 << 12)
[all …]
/device/soc/rockchip/common/vendor/drivers/gpu/arm/midgard/
Dmali_base_kernel.h128 typedef u32 base_mem_alloc_flags; typedef
138 #define BASE_MEM_PROT_CPU_RD ((base_mem_alloc_flags)1 << 0)
142 #define BASE_MEM_PROT_CPU_WR ((base_mem_alloc_flags)1 << 1)
146 #define BASE_MEM_PROT_GPU_RD ((base_mem_alloc_flags)1 << 2)
150 #define BASE_MEM_PROT_GPU_WR ((base_mem_alloc_flags)1 << 3)
154 #define BASE_MEM_PROT_GPU_EX ((base_mem_alloc_flags)1 << 4)
169 #define BASE_MEM_GROW_ON_GPF ((base_mem_alloc_flags)1 << 9)
173 #define BASE_MEM_COHERENT_SYSTEM ((base_mem_alloc_flags)1 << 10)
177 #define BASE_MEM_COHERENT_LOCAL ((base_mem_alloc_flags)1 << 11)
181 #define BASE_MEM_CACHED_CPU ((base_mem_alloc_flags)1 << 12)
[all …]
/device/soc/rockchip/common/vendor/drivers/gpu/arm/bifrost/
Dmali_base_kernel.h86 typedef u32 base_mem_alloc_flags; typedef
703 static inline int base_mem_group_id_get(base_mem_alloc_flags flags) in base_mem_group_id_get()
721 static inline base_mem_alloc_flags base_mem_group_id_set(int id) in base_mem_group_id_set()
728 return ((base_mem_alloc_flags)id << BASEP_MEM_GROUP_ID_SHIFT) & BASE_MEM_GROUP_ID_MASK; in base_mem_group_id_set()
/device/soc/rockchip/rk3588/kernel/include/uapi/gpu/arm/bifrost/
Dmali_base_kernel.h81 typedef __u32 base_mem_alloc_flags; typedef
711 (((base_mem_alloc_flags)((id < 0 || id >= BASE_MEM_GROUP_COUNT) ? \
/device/soc/rockchip/common/kernel/drivers/gpu/arm/bifrost/
Dmali_kbase_mem.h2157 static inline int kbase_mem_group_id_get(base_mem_alloc_flags flags) in kbase_mem_group_id_get()
2175 static inline base_mem_alloc_flags kbase_mem_group_id_set(int id) in kbase_mem_group_id_set()